Open Access Technology International, Inc. (OATI) is seeking a professional, customer-service-oriented Front Desk & Office Services Coordinator to support our Bloomington location. This role reports 100% on site and is essential in creating a welcoming environment for guests, including, employees, vendors, and VIPs, while ensuring smooth office operations. The starting salary range for the role ranges from $42,000.00 – $52,000.
Key Responsibilities:
Manage meeting room reservations and ensure seamless event logistics
Answer and direct calls professionally
Assign badges to guests and new employees
Stock and manage office supplies
Assist the Talent Team
Coordinate shipments, deliveries, and vendor escorts
Support building security, monitor gate access, and report turnstile issues
Respond to alarms and document security concerns
Assist the Training Department with tracking registrations and participant lists
Send customer notifications via Outlook (reminders, confirmations, follow-ups)
Ensure meeting areas remain clean, organized, and event-ready
Oversee event setup, ensuring a seamless experience for VIP guests
Coordinate food orders for internal and external events, managing vendor and catering logistics, preparing requisition form
Maintain detailed documentation of training attendance and scheduling
Qualifications:
Associate's degree (preferred) or equivalent experience
Strong attention to detail, organization, and multitasking skills
Proficiency in MS Office and professional phone etiquette
Ability to work independently and manage time effectively
Legally authorized to work in the U.S. without requiring sponsorship now or in the future
Ability to lift office supplies as needed
